- The distance between Nakhon Si Thammarat, Thailand and Cambridge Bay, Nt, Canada is approximately 11,165 km or 6,938 mi.
- To reach Nakhon Si Thammarat in this distance one would set out from Cambridge Bay, Nt bearing 334.8°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Nakhon Si Thammarat bearing 188.8° or S .
- Nakhon Si Thammarat has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as Cambridge Bay, Nt has a tundra climate (ET).
- Nakhon Si Thammarat is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Cambridge Bay, Nt is in or near the subpolar moist tundra biome.
- The mean temperature is 42.2 °C (76°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 38.8 °C (69.8°F) less in Nakhon Si Thammarat.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2240 mm (88.2 in) more which is equivalent to 2240 l/m² (54.97 US gal/ft²) or 22,400,000 l/ha (2,394,709 US gal/ac) more. About 16 8/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 52.9° higher in Nakhon Si Thammarat than in Cambridge Bay, Nt.
